搜索

首页  >  问答  >  正文

git中怎样将工作区未提交的修改转移到新分支?

假设我现在的分支是develop,我在开始新的需求前忘了开新分支,就直接开始在工作区修改了,写到一半,现在我想开新的分支名为skin,并且把工作区的修改转到新分支上,清理干净我本地develop工作区的修改,并切换到新分支上继续进行工作。该怎么操作?

怪我咯怪我咯2793 天前577

全部回复(5)我来回复

  • 伊谢尔伦

    伊谢尔伦2017-05-02 09:38:31

    直接切换分支就行

    回复
    0
  • 天蓬老师

    天蓬老师2017-05-02 09:38:31

    直接切换分支,本地的修改和分支是不绑定的,你切换过去修改还在。

    回复
    0
  • 我想大声告诉你

    我想大声告诉你2017-05-02 09:38:31

    git stash,然后再本地新建分支并切换到新分支,然后执行git stash pop,可以试试,应该可行

    回复
    0
  • 高洛峰

    高洛峰2017-05-02 09:38:31

    直接在你本地新建skin分支,然后直接切换到你skin分支

    回复
    0
  • phpcn_u1582

    phpcn_u15822017-05-02 09:38:31

    雷雷

    回复
    0
  • 取消回复